Install both the oc and the theme file.... Non give me overclock option. SetCPU give me only 1000 max.... Answers! Please! Did a full write in both tries!

Sent from my HTC Glacier using XDA App
You want the THEME version installed as that is the most current. In SetCPU you need to change device, if you already have selected a device before like me (I picked Tegra chipset) you need to hit the menu button and pick Device or whatever it is called at the bottom left then go all the way to the bottom of the list and select custom. Then Voila! You can now set 1400Mhz! It is a beautiful thing. Warning though, back of the Streak gets pretty dang hot at that setting.

    Update 11/05/11

    StreakDroid7 1.3 :)

    changelog
    no huge changes
    rebuilt kernel with more stability at higher overclocks, also auto detect speeds in setcpu will work fine now.
    added GPU Overclock which also boosts the base gpu clock so performance should be increased all round
    reduced the max framerate to fix gfx courrptions

    http://mirror2.streakdroid.com/Streakdroid7-v1.3.zip

    Update 22/04/11

    time for a new build again :D

    minor tweaks in this version and one large change :D

    changelog:
    Minor tweaks to kernel
    Removed 1.6ghz Overclock
    Tweaked 1.504ghz should work better
    Added 1.3ghz clock speed
    Finally managed to uncap the framerate of device, now hitting over 100fps on some items,
    thanks to dexter_nlb for pointing me in the right direction on the above :)

    overclock should be pretty much rock solid up to 1.4ghz but above that you may see lockups, also not all devices are the same and some will not handle overclock as well
